DevToys 是一款专为开发者设计的集成化多功能工具箱,它集成了超过30种实用工具,旨在帮助开发者提升编码效率、简化日常开发流程。这款工具完全离线运行,能够有效保护用户的敏感数据安全。

主要功能
转换器 (Converters)
- JSON/YAML 互转:快速将 JSON 格式转换为 YAML 格式,或反之。
- 时间戳数字转换:将数字转换为二进制、浮点数、十六进制等格式。
编码器/解码器 (Encoders/Decoders)
- HTML/URL 编码解码:对 HTML 实体和 URL 参数进行编码和解码。
- Base64 编解码:轻松处理 Base64 编码和解码任务。
- JWT 解码器:解析和验证 JSON Web Tokens,确保数据的安全性。
- JSON 格式化:美化 JSON 代码,使其更易于阅读和编辑。
- SQL 格式化:整理 SQL 查询语句,提高代码可读性。
- XML 格式化:优化 XML 文档结构,使其更加规范。
生成器 (Generators)
- 哈希生成:生成 MD5、SHA1、SHA256、SHA512 等哈希值,用于数据校验和加密。
- UUID 生成:快速生成唯一标识符,适用于各种需要唯一性的场景。
- Lorem Ipsum:生成随机文本,用于占位符或测试。
文本处理 (Text)
- Escape/Unescape:对文本进行转义和反转义操作,确保文本的正确显示和处理。
- 正则表达式测试器:测试和验证正则表达式,确保匹配逻辑的正确性。
- 文本比较器:比较两个文本文件的差异,便于代码审查和版本控制。
图像处理 (Graphic)
- 色盲模拟器:模拟色盲视觉,优化 UI 设计,确保设计的可访问性。
- 颜色选择器和对比度:帮助选择和对比颜色,提升设计的视觉效果。
- 图像压缩器:减小图像文件大小,优化加载速度,提升网页性能。
测试工具 (Testers)
- 正则表达式测试:提供实时匹配预览、分组捕获和替换功能,便于正则表达式的调试和优化。
- JSONPath 验证:验证 JSONPath 表达式的正确性,确保数据查询的准确性。
应用优势
- 一站式工具集:集成了多种常用工具,省去了在不同工具间反复切换的麻烦,有效提升了开发效率。
- 离线运行:完全支持离线运行,无需将数据上传到不明网站进行处理,最大程度保障了数据隐私和安全。
- 智能检测:能够自动分析剪贴板内容,并智能推荐最适合的处理工具。无论是 JSON 数据、Base64 编码还是正则表达式,都能快速匹配。
- 轻量级:每个工具模块独立,只占用必要的系统资源,保证了软件整体的流畅与轻便。
- 易用性:界面直观清晰,操作简单明了,即使是开发新手也能快速上手,几乎没有学习成本。
- 实时更新:作为一个活跃的开源实战项目,DevToys 会定期更新,不断添加新工具并优化现有功能,紧跟开发者需求。
- 跨平台兼容:支持 Windows、macOS 和 Linux 系统,在不同操作系统上提供一致的功能体验,方便团队协作。
- 可扩展性:支持通过扩展市场安装更多工具。用户可以浏览并一键安装所需工具,新工具会自动集成到对应的分类中,满足个性化需求。
应用场景
- API 开发调试:收到混乱的 JSON 响应时,使用 DevToys 的一键格式化功能,能即时检测语法错误并完成数据验证。
- 数据处理工作流:复制待处理的数据后,DevToys 的智能推荐能帮你精准选择工具,快速执行操作并获取结果。
- 工作流自动化:可以将常用工具组合成个性化工作流,通过快捷键快速触发,实现一键完成复杂任务。
如需了解更多详细信息,如具体使用技巧或高级功能,可以访问其官方网站或查阅相关的技术文档。
GitHub地址
https://github.com/DevToys-app/DevToys
下载地址
https://devtoys.app/download
|